@charset "UTF-8";
/* CSS Document */

input {
	font-family: Helvetica, Arial sans-serif;
	font-size: 8pt;
}

#footer{
font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#000000;
	font-weight: none;
	line-height: 13pt;
	padding-top:40px;
	}

#container_logotop {
	position: absolute;
	top: 0px;
	left: 0px;
}

#container_nav {position: absolute; top: 0px; left: 505px;}
#container_nav_home {
	position: absolute;
	top: 0px;
	left: 505px;
}
#container_nav_news {position: absolute; top: 0px; left: 568px;}
#container_nav_bicycles {position: absolute; top: 0px; left: 631px;}
#container_nav_directions {position: absolute; top: 0px; left: 720px;}
#container_nav_about_us {position: absolute; top: 0px; left: 829px;}

#container_subscribe {position: absolute; top: 140px; left: 635px;}

#container_logobottom {
	position: absolute;
	top: 136px;
	left: 0px;
}

#container_leftbanner {
	position: absolute;
	top: 203px;
	left: 0px;
}

#container_rightbanner {
	position: absolute;
	top: 203px;
	left: 883px;
}

#container_email {
	position: absolute;
	top: 136px;
	left: 505px;
}

#container_ur {
	position: absolute;
	top: 0px;
	left: 984px;
}

#container_left {
	position: absolute;
	top: 202px;
	left: 0px;
}

#container_right {
	position: absolute;
	top: 202px;
	left: 884px;
}

#container_pageban {
	position: absolute;
	top: 222px;
	left: 131px;
}

#page_content {
border: 0px dotted blue;
	position: absolute;
	top: 289px;
	left: 145px;
	width: 727px;
}

#home_numbers {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16pt;
	color: #383838;
	font-weight: bold;
}

#home_descriptions {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: none;
	line-height: 13pt;
}

#news_date {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 24pt;
	color: #383838;
	font-weight: bold;
}

#news_headline {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14pt;
	color: #000000;
	font-weight: bold;
}

#news_content {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: none;
	line-height: 14pt;
}

#bicycles_brand {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13pt;
	color: #383838;
	font-weight: bold;
}

#bicycles_subtitle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 24pt;
	color: #383838;
	font-weight: bold;
}

#bicycles_link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#000000;
	font-weight: none;
}

#directions_head {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12pt;
	color: #383838;
	font-weight: bold;
}

#directions_content {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: none;
	line-height: 13pt;
}

#about_us_content {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: none;
	line-height: 13pt;
}

#about_us_contact {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: none;
	line-height: 13pt;
}

a:link, a:active, a:visited {
	text-decoration: none;
	color: #008445;
}

a:hover {
	text-decoration: none;
	color: #000000;
	background: #acacac;
}

#brand_border {
	border: 1px solid;
	border-color: #acacac;
}

H1{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14pt;
	color: #000000;
	font-weight: bold;
	padding: 0px 0px 0px 0px;
	margin: 0px 0px -10px 0px;
}

.service_content {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#000000;
	font-weight: none;
	line-height: 14pt;
}

.knockout{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#ffffff;
	padding: 2px 2px 2px 2px;
	margin: 0px 0px 0px 0px;
	background: #008445;
}

Hr{
	border-top: 1px dotted #008445;
	background color: #008445;
	color: #008445;
	
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 10px 0px;
}
